Ticket TL-442: The staging instance of Chronoplan, our school timetable solver, was deployed with the production solver queue credentials. This means staging runs can enqueue jobs against live district schedules at Hollowbrook Academy. We need to rotate the affected credential and point staging at its own queue. For the security review, note that the fix requires updating the staging .env with the following line:

vault entry, tagug-hahip: ARCHIVE_KEY3=e34

Day One checklist — item 4: Archive room orientation. Contractors working on the Halloway Wing refurbishment must collect any reference drawings from the archive room in the basement of Dunmore House. Take the stairs beside the loading bay, sign the ledger at the bottom, and keep the fire door closed behind you. The keypad entry code for the archive room door is listed below.

turnstile pass: bdg-QZV-3

# Versioning for the Brindlekit shared component library follows strict semver.
# Minor bumps ship weekly; majors require sign-off from the Larkspur release board.
# The version registry service reads published tags and records them per release train.
# Before cutting a release, confirm the registry is reachable using the connection string below.

replica DSN, kajep-yahag: mssql://praok_svc:iF@db-8d68.plorvaio.local:5432/eliion